The ASX200 has been up 0.32% at around 8,257 points.

Mineral Resources Ltd (ASX:MIN) has been well-watched on HotCopper today, after rising 5.65% despite news that superannuation fund HESTA has sold its remaining stake in the company, citing ‘serious governance concerns’.

MinRes has been $22.25.

South32 Ltd (ASX:S32) has risen 2.51% after telling investors that chief executive Graham Kerr will be leaving next year after more than 10 years at the company, and that Matthew Daly – who is currently and executive, and technical and operations director at AngloAmerican Plc – will be stepping into the role.

South32 has been $2.86.

And Neuren Pharmaceuticals Ltd (ASX:NEU) has been down 6.1% after announcing the buyback of more than 127 million securities, and following commentary from Donald Trump in which he vowed to cut prescription drug prices by up to 80% via an executive order.

Neuren has been trading at $12.48.
